Seven Seas!Fans of this high-seas adventure game are in for a treat... and folks who haven't experienced Seven Seas yet are about to get their chance! You can play this Windows version on your home PC anytime you like, offline or on. But that's not all! You also get: Terrific new graphics, featuring 3d rendered pirates and monsters! Booming, realistic sound effects! A brand new soundtrack composed especially for Seven Seas by Skaven, the maestro behind the Bejeweled and Alchemy music! All new enemies to face, including the Blue Buccaneers and the Flying Dutchman! Brand new bonus stage... can you unlock the secret of Treasure Island? Interactive tutorial for beginners! Save your high scores locally, or upload them to our web site to compete with others from around the world!Ahoy, matey! Set sail for adventure with Seven Seas for Windows, the home PC version of the hit action/puzzle game! Adding a host of new enemies and the Treasure Island bonus stage, the Windows version also features enhanced 3d graphics, awesome sound fx, and a brand new soundtrack from Future Crew maestro Skaven.
